Homepage » hogyan kell » Kezdő Geek Hogyan viselkedni fog a saját honlapja Windows-on (WAMP)

    Kezdő Geek Hogyan viselkedni fog a saját honlapja Windows-on (WAMP)

    A saját webhelyének tárolása nem kell havi díjat fizetnie, vagy sok technikai tudást igényel a beállításhoz. Ha csak egy kis webhelyet kell rendeznie, amely csak néhány látogatóval rendelkezik, a Windows PC-t WAMP szerverré alakíthatja.

    Ha Ön saját webhelyet fogad?

    Miközben a saját webhelyének otthoni számítógépén való tárolása nagyon szórakoztató, ha azt szeretné, hogy egy webhely, amelyre az emberek ténylegesen hozzáférhetnek, érdemes lehet valahol saját web hosting tervet készíteni. Bluehost kínál korlátlan web hosting 3,95 $ havonta, teljes mértékben támogatja a PHP és a MySQL. Ez minden bizonnyal egy egyszerű módja annak, hogy elkezdhessük a weboldalt, és egyszerű telepítéssel rendelkeznek egy egyszerű kattintással, hogy elindítsák a népszerű szoftverekkel, mint például a WordPress és mások..

    Ha Ön saját helyi webhelyet fogad, amelyhez az emberek hozzáférhetnek, akkor meg kell nyitnia a tűzfalat az otthoni számítógépén, és ez azt jelenti, hogy potenciálisan megnyithat bizonyos biztonsági lyukakat. Mindenképpen érdemes meggondolni egy olcsó hosting terv megszerzését máshol, mint a Bluehost vagy a Hostgator.

    Ha csak egy helyi fejlesztési szervert szeretne, akkor olvassa tovább.

    Mi az a „WAMP”?

    A WAMP egy „Windows, Apache, MySQL és PHP” rövidítése. A WAMP letöltésekor csak olyan programot tölthet le, amely három különböző dolgot telepít. A WAMP-ok kényelmesek, mert lehetővé teszik a dinamikus webes tartalom tárolásához szükséges összes csomag letöltését és telepítését egy csapásra. Ellenkező esetben a három csomagot külön kell letöltenie.

    ablakok - A „W” a WAMP-ban csak azért van megadva, hogy a program kompatibilis legyen a Windows operációs rendszerekkel.

    Apache - Ez az a program, amelyet a webhely tényleges fogadására használnak. Ezzel egyedül HTML-fájlokat és egyéb statikus webtartalmat tud fogadni.

    MySQL - Ez egy adatbázist biztosít a webes tartalomhoz. Sok dinamikus weboldalnak kell tárolnia az adatokat (azaz a webes fiókok felhasználónevét és jelszavát), ahol a MySQL jön.

    PHP - A legnépszerűbb nyelv a dinamikus webtartalom írásához - messze. A WordPress, a Facebook, a Joomla és számos más weboldal és tartalomkezelő rendszer a PHP-t használja. Ha a statikus weboldalakon kívül többet tervez, a PHP alapvető társ.

    Ha a Windows helyett Linuxot futtat, telepítenie kell egy LAMP-ot. Lehetőség van egy webhelyet is kiszolgálni a Windows rendszeren az IIS segítségével, így nem kell harmadik féltől származó szoftvert telepíteni. Az IIS útvonal használata nem ajánlott a legtöbb célra, és sokkal inkább egy olyan folyamat, amely támogatja a dinamikus webtartalmat - így ragaszkodjon a WAMP-hez, hacsak nincs egyedi körülménye, amelyhez IIS szükséges.

    Mielőtt továbblépnénk, kérjük, értse meg, hogy a webhelynek a mindennapi PC-n és a fogyasztói minőségű internetkapcsolaton való tárolása nem ajánlott a tesztelésen túl, és / vagy egy kis webhelyet néhány látogató számára. Ne feledje, hogy a következő alkalommal, amikor a Windows Update-nek újra kell indítania a rendszert, az Ön webhelye együtt megy - nem ideális helyzet egy komoly webhelyhez.


    A WAMP telepítése

    Sok WAMP program áll rendelkezésre, de a WampServerrel együtt dolgozunk. Vezesse át a honlapjukat, és töltse le a legfrissebb programjukat, majd indítsa el a telepítést.

    A telepítési utasítások önmagukban nem magyarázhatók; csak tartsa mindent az alapértelmezett értékén, és tartsa nyomva a Tovább gombot. A WampServer alapértelmezett böngészőjének használatához, ha úgy dönt, hogy megvizsgálja webhelyét, egyszerűen kattintson a Megnyitás gombra.

    Győződjön meg róla, hogy az Apache biztonsági kivételét is hozzáadja a Windows tűzfalhoz:

    Amikor a telepítés befejeződött, jelölje be a „Start WampServer 2 most” jelölőnégyzetet a befejezés előtt. Látnod kell a programot az értesítési területen.

    Kattintson a bal egérgombbal az ikonra, és a webhely megnyitásához nyomja meg a „Localhost” gombot a kiválasztási menü tetején.

    Az alapértelmezett oldal jelenleg csak gyors információs oldalt jelenít meg, így meggyőződhetünk arról, hogy az összes összetevő megfelelően működik. Ha látja ezt a képernyőt, akkor sikeresen telepítette a WAMP szervert.

    Néhány gyors hibaelhárítás

    Ezt a programot több teszt telepítettük, és megállapítottuk, hogy a Microsoft néhány csomagja elengedhetetlen ahhoz, hogy a WampServer megfelelően működjön. Ha eddig még mindig hibát észlelt, győződjön meg róla, hogy telepítette a következő frissítéseket, távolítsa el a WampServer programot, indítsa újra a számítógépet, és telepítse újra a WampServer programot.

    WAMP 32 bites szükséges csomagok:
    Microsoft Visual C ++ 2008 SP1 újratelepíthető csomag (x86)
    Microsoft Visual C ++ 2010 SP1 újratelepíthető csomag (x86)
    Microsoft Visual C ++ 2012 (válassza a vcredist_x86.exe fájlt)

    WAMP 64 bites szükséges csomagok:
    A Microsoft Visual C ++ 2008 SP1 újratelepíthető csomagja (x86) (ez nem helyesírás - szüksége van az x86 csomagra)
    Microsoft Visual C ++ 2008 újraelosztható csomag (x64)
    Microsoft Visual C ++ 2010 SP1 újratelepíthető csomag (x64)
    Microsoft Visual C ++ 2012 (válassza a vcredist_x64.exe fájlt)

    További WAMP konfiguráció

    A webkiszolgáló által megjelenített oldal (ok) megváltoztatásához nyissa meg a www könyvtárat, a bal egérgombbal kattintva a WAMP ikonra az értesítési területen.

    A megnyíló mappa az, ahol meg kell adnia a webhelyén tárolni kívánt fájlokat. A WordPress telepítőfájljaiból a statikus HTML-fájlokba bármi is elhelyezhető, és a módosítások egyszerre fognak megjelenni a webhelyén (csak kattintson a Frissítés).

    Nézzünk meg egy gyors példát arra, hogy hogyan kell a tartalmat ebbe a mappába dobni, hogy azt a webhelyén kézbesítse. Használhat egy webfejlesztési programot vagy valami olyan egyszerű dolgot, mint a Jegyzettömb, hogy hozzon létre egy alapvető PHP oldalt, és tegye azt a webhelyére.

    A következő kód jó kezdet lesz:



    PHP teszt


    Helló Világ

    „ ?>

    Illessze be ezt a kódot a Jegyzettömbbe, és mentse el a fájlt index.php-ben a C:

    Most térjen vissza a webhelyére (vagy kattintson a frissítésre [F5], ha már megnyitotta), és látni fogja az éppen létrehozott oldalt.

    Alapértelmezés szerint a webhelye jelenleg csak a WampServer telepített számítógépén érhető el. Ez tökéletes azok számára, akik csak WAMP-kiszolgálójukat használják tesztelési vagy fejlesztési célokra, de a webhely hozzáférhetővé tétele a világ többi részén, kattintson a WampServer ikonra, majd kattintson az „Online” lehetőségre..

    Alapértelmezés szerint az Apache konfigurációs fájlja úgy van beállítva, hogy megtagadja a bejövő kapcsolatokat mindenkinek, kivéve a localhostot, így két kódsorot is meg kell változtatnia, így a többi eszköz nem látja a „403 Forbidden” hibát, amikor megpróbál betölteni te oldalad. A httpd.conf (Apache konfigurációs fájl) eléréséhez kattintson a bal egérgombbal a WampServer menüre, és nézze meg az Apache mappát.

    Görgessen lefelé, amíg meg nem jelenik a kód:

    Rendelés megtagadása, engedélyezés

    Tiltsa le mindent

    Törölje ezt a kódot, és cserélje ki:

    Rendelés engedélyezése, megtagadás

    Engedjék meg mindent

    Mentse el a módosításokat a httpd.conf fájlba, és indítsa újra az összes szolgáltatást.

    Az Ön webhelyének most elérhetőnek kell lennie a World Wide Web-től. Ha nem, ellenőrizze, hogy a 80-as portot továbbította-e a számítógépére az útválasztón.